What placement truly means

Alignment is the partnership between the angles at which your wheels fulfill the roadway and exactly how those angles direct the auto. 3 primary angles specify it: camber, wheel, and toe. Each serves a various function, and each engages with the others.

Camber is the internal or outside tilt of the tire when checked out from the front. A little bit of negative camber can aid a performance auto bite in edges, yet excessive unfavorable camber chews the inner shoulder of a tire in a couple of thousand miles. Favorable camber does the contrary, pushing wear external. Camber is typically flexible on dual wishbone or multi-link suspensions and less so on fundamental MacPherson struts unless slotted bolts or camber plates are installed.

Caster is the forward or rearward tilt of the steering pivot, checked out from the side. Picture the front casters on a buying cart. They route behind their installing point, self-centering as you press. Automotive caster is comparable. Extra positive wheel gives an automobile much better straight-line stability and steering feeling. Unequal caster side to side can create a vehicle to draw, even if camber and toe look fine. On several modern autos, caster is fixed or has actually restricted modification, that makes diagnosis and structure integrity much more essential after accidents.

Toe is just how much the wheels direct inward or outside when viewed from above. Toe has the most instant effect on tire wear and stability. A somewhat toe-in front end assists with straight-line stability, while toe-out accelerates turn-in but can make a cars and truck worried. Excessive toe, even a few millimeters, will scrub tread rapidly. Toe is generally the easiest adjustment to make and the one most likely to wander over time, particularly as tie rod finishes wear.

There is a fourth variable, frequently overlooked: propelled angle. This explains the direction the rear axle factors relative to the vehicle's centerline. If the thrust angle is off, the vehicle can "canine track," where the rear end actions a little sidewards as you travel directly. On lorries with independent back suspension, rear toe and camber influence drive angle straight. On solid axle trucks and older cars, worn bushings or bent components can move the axle and create the very same effect.

The factor is not to remember interpretations, but to understand that positioning is a set of gauged concessions. Designers specify varieties since cars and trucks offer several usages and face imperfect roads. A great positioning targets the best side of those arrays for how the car is driven and what it carries.

Why alignment drifts

Cars do not survive on alignment shelfs. They bounce, fill, warm, and great throughout miles of patched asphalt. With time, a couple of pressures nudge placement out of place.

First is wear in bushings, ball joints, and link rod ends. Rubber control arm bushings relocate a lot, and they anchor the geometry. As rubber ages, it compresses and fractures. The angle you established two years ago slowly adjustments. Secondly is effect. Striking a pit at 40 mph or clipping a visual can bend a connection rod or kneed a control arm. The change may be little, yet it appears as a guiding wheel slightly off facility or a brand-new tendency to wander. Third is ride elevation change. Springs droop, and aftermarket configurations lower or elevate a vehicle. Since suspensions are developed with geometry that moves with the travel arc, any change in elevation changes static camber and toe. That's why an appropriate positioning always starts with inspecting adventure height and examining spring and shock condition.

I've seen brand new cars and trucks with off-center wheels on distribution due to transport tie-down anxiety or a nicked connection rod boot that stopped working early. I've likewise seen a 12-year-old minivan that made it through on a diet plan of city speed bumps, still within specification since its proprietor changed bushings promptly and maintained tires at appropriate stress. Roads and care matter.

Symptoms that deserve your attention

Drivers describe alignment problems in plain language: the car draws, the wheel sits uneven, the tires sing, the automobile feels twitchy. Each signs and symptom mean a likely reason, but diagnosis ought to never ever miss a physical inspection.

A pull to one side on a flat, low-wind day usually points to a cross-caster or cross-camber issue, or a dragging brake caliper. If the pull modifications sides when you exchange front tires left to right, you may have a radial pull from a tire with a production bias. That's one reason specialists practice run both prior to and after alignments.

An off-center steering wheel with the cars and truck tracking straight normally means total toe is correct but the wheel was not focused during the toe modification. It may also hint at an uncorrected thrust angle at the back, which compels the front to compensate.

Uneven tire wear patterns inform stories. Feathered sides claim toe. Inside wear claims unfavorable camber or too much load. Outdoors wear states positive camber or hostile cornering on underinflated fronts. Cupping can indicate worn shocks, yet chronic toe problems can make it worse. Take a picture before the solution and after a couple of thousand miles. You'll discover to check out tread like a mechanic reviews plugs.

Vibrations and noise do not always indicate placement, but they commonly ride along. A cupped tire will hum like a worn wheel bearing. A curved wheel from a hole strike adds a shake that a positioning won't treat. Excellent shops check both.

What a comprehensive positioning service looks like

A proper placement isn't just spinning knobs while watching a display. It starts with a discussion, an examination drive, and a look beneath. The technician asks how the auto is made use of. Does it commute solo or lug two children and a trunk filled with equipment? Is the chauffeur reporting a pull on all roads or on crowned surfaces? What regarding tire age and turning background? These details lead targets within the factory specs.

Next is inspection. If tie rods have play, if control arm bushings are fractured and strolling, if a strut is leaking and the adventure elevation is off by more than a quarter inch from spec, a positioning can not hold. An excellent car repair service will pleasantly refuse to line up until the mechanical concerns are dealt with, not to be hard, but since the job won't last.

On the shelf, the shop makes use of positioning heads or targets that check out each wheel's position relative to the vehicle centerline. Modern systems compensate for wheel runout so a curved edge does not shake off the numbers. The specialist locks the steering wheel at center, sets the back first on a four-wheel positioning car to establish drive angle, then changes the front to match. Caster, where adjustable, gets set prior to toe, due to the fact that changing caster or camber will certainly alter toe.

Here's where experience matters. Manufacturing facility specifications are varieties. On a car that spends most of its time on a crowned road, the tech could prejudice the camber or wheel a little within spec to combat the crown pull. On cars and trucks with broad staggered tires, a little additional favorable caster can aid self-centering and stability. On reduced cars and trucks, the technician might suggest camber adjustment sets to avoid consuming internal shoulders. Those are judgment calls born from doing this service real roadways, not from staring at green numbers.

Before the car leaves, the shop examination drives again, confirms the wheel is focused, and publishes the before-and-after measurements. If your regional mechanic hands you a sheet revealing that the left front camber is near the side of specification while the right is in the middle, and they clarify why they left it there to keep the auto directly on your daily route, take that as an indicator you're in experienced hands.

Alignment and modern chauffeur aids

Stability control, lane maintaining help, and adaptive cruise all assume the cars and truck is sharp where the sensors think it is. An uneven steering angle sensing unit informs lane centering to nudge the cars and truck when it must sit still. A bad drive angle alters the yaw rate vs. guiding input correlation that security control expects. Many lorries require a guiding angle sensor calibration after a placement. Some need a video camera alignment if the windscreen was replaced. It's not a racket, it's just how the systems talk. If a store aligns your car and the lane maintain goes wacky, ask whether they did any type of required resets. Commonly it's a fast software application procedure.

Special instances and trade-offs

Not every vehicle goes for the exact same geometry. Efficiency autos take advantage of a little bit more adverse camber to keep the tire level in a difficult corner. That trades even straight-line wear for grasp. Owners usually approve much faster inside wear because the payback is an auto that feels to life on a hill roadway or throughout a weekend break autocross. Connect your top priorities. The specialist can set the front camber at the aggressive end of specification and keep back toe conservative to avoid nervous highway manners.

Trucks and SUVs that tow take advantage of rear ride height assistants or airbags to keep geometry in variety under lots. If you align a vehicle unladen, then hitch a trailer with 500 extra pounds of tongue weight, the back sags and the front geometry modifications. In that instance, some stores will include ballast to simulate regular tons throughout alignment. It's even more job, but the result is true to genuine use.

Vehicles with aftermarket wheels and tires need unique interest. Bigger tires adhere to ruts and enhance small toe problems. If you change balanced out dramatically, you change scrub span, which changes guiding feel and kickback. Positioning can reduce a few of that, but physics still uses. That's a discussion worth having before getting components, not after seeing tramlining on the freeway.

Tires, stress, and the placement triangle

Tires are the final partners in the placement equation. They bring their own traits. Various models have various step accounts and carcass stiffness. A grand touring tire with soft sidewalls can really feel obscure at manufacturing facility toe settings, while an ultra-high efficiency tire breaks to focus with the very same numbers. Stress issues equally as much. An underinflated front overemphasizes outside shoulder wear and dulls reaction. Overinflated rears can make an automobile skate over bumps and feel anxious, leading a chauffeur to suspect placement when the repair is air.

When you get new tires, ask the store to establish chilly pressures suitable to your use, not just the placard. If you drive half your miles at 75 mph in summer heat, a slight chilly stress decrease can maintain warm pressures in the pleasant spot. Then schedule an alignment so the tire and geometry start their life together correctly.
